Asset allocation choices form the foundation of an effective strategic investment plan, with academic research consistent in showing that these selections account for most of investment results variance over time. The procedure entails determining the optimal mix of different asset classes according to a capitalist's risk tolerance, time frame, and financial goals. Dynamic property distribution methods have acquired popularity among institutional investors like the CEO of the US investor of Sysco Corporation, enabling tactical modifications based on market conditions while preserving adherence to sustained objectives. This method recognizes that market cycles create short-lived chances where certain asset classes turn briefly over or underpriced compared with their long-term prospects.

Portfolio diversification remains a core principle the essential tenets of prudent investment, serving as the key protection versus unforeseen market movements and sector-specific dangers. Modern diversification strategies extend past the conventional method of blending equities and bonds, including non-traditional properties such as real estate, commodities, private equity, and international securities across developed and emerging markets. The essential factor is comprehending correlation patterns among various property categories and how these connections can change during market stress periods.
